About Silver Birch Lodge

Escape to Silver Birch Lodge, a serene haven nestled in the Nottinghamshire countryside, perfect for a romantic retreat. This all-ground-floor lodge sleeps two, offering a cosy double bedroom, a modern shower room, and an inviting open-plan living space complete with a woodburning stove.

The lodge boasts a private garden where you can unwind in the wood-fired hot tub, gazing at the stars or enjoying the tranquil views.

For indoor entertainment, an external shared games room features a full-size snooker table, dart board, and table football.

Immerse yourself in the peaceful surroundings and relish the luxury of this intimate accommodation. Whether seeking relaxation or activities, Silver Birch Lodge provides a perfect base for a memorable getaway.

Helpful Info To Get More From Your Stay

What do guests love about this accommodation?

Guests love the immaculate cleanliness, the warm welcome from the hosts, and the stunning surroundings of Silver Birch Lodge. The wood-fired hot tub is a particular highlight, along with the cosy fireplace and the well-equipped games room. The local pub's friendly atmosphere and excellent food also receive high praise.

Getting there

To get to Silver Birch Lodge, if travelling by car, take the A1 motorway and exit towards the A631. For rail travellers, the nearest train station is in Retford, from where a short taxi ride will bring you to the lodge.

For families with Kids

This destination is ideal for families, offering a secure garden for play and a games room for entertainment. The nearby Yorkshire Wildlife Park provides a fun day out, while local walks along the canal and river are perfect for family adventures.

Is Silver Birch Lodge A good location for couples?

For couples seeking a romantic escape, this destination offers tranquillity and privacy. Enjoy leisurely walks, unwind in the hot tub, or visit the charming town of Bawtry for a romantic meal. The nearby Gainsborough Old Hall also makes for a fascinating day out.

Dining and Cafes

The Pantry 8020 offers delightful meals (phone number not provided). The Red Hart and The Waterfront Inn serve hearty pub fare, while The Ferry House is ideal for a riverside dining experience.

Within walking distance of your cottage

A short walk away you'll find local shops, inns, and scenic canal and river walks, perfect for leisurely strolls and immersing in village life.

Normanby Hall Country Park - DN15 9HU
about 17 Miles
Normanby Hall Country Park has a fantastically tranquil location Set in the 300 acres of Normanby Hall estate offering a relaxing choice for a family day out. The stunning grounds are abundant with wildlife as well as beautiful flora and fauna and there is no better place for a summer picnic. There is also plenty of open space for children to run around. The Deer park is sure to be a big hit with the children with herds of fallow deer to spot.
Xscape Castleford - WF10 4TA
about 25 Miles
Located in the Castleford area of West Yorkshire this is a fun family day out with loads of activities under one roof.   For the energetic there is a real snow slop for skiing and rock climbing walls.  For the more laid back then there is a cinema and bowling alley.  This place caters for all ages and there are seasonal events on throughout the year too.
